Penn State PRIDE

pridePenn State PRIDE is a new student organization on campus. Its goal? Let’s let their official site describe it.

We ARE a group of Penn State students who decided to mobilize ourselves to perpetuate the traditions of our University and ensure that we have a welcoming environment for ALL fans. We want to inspire a sense of honor and pride in all Penn Staters: Pride in our history; Pride in our University; Pride in ourselves. The “PRIDE.” Is here.

In order to accomplish their goals, PRIDE sponsors athletic events, gives presentations, and uses any medium possible to relay their message. They have attended sportsmanship conferences, hosted representatives of rival teams, and more.

PRIDE is accepting applications for general membership now! So join, for the glory.

Kiwi Fro-Yo Comes to Penn State

The Kiwi Yogurt chain is opening its newest store right here in State College, next to the Student Book Store at 324 E. College Ave, this February (no word yet on exact date). Kiwi is a Maine Line, Pa.-based, family-owned company founded in 2008 set on providing “the ultimate dessert experience.”

And it is quite the experience. When you walk in, there is – prepare yourselves – a wall of frozen yogurt options. You get to walk up to this beautiful wall and vend yourself as many flavors as you like.
